37" tires on my 2005
Anyone ever squeezed 37's underneath a 2005. I will be upgrading to bilstien 5160 here shortly and I am wondering if 37x12.50 will fit underneath my truck. Thanks

Re: 37
I did bfg km2s in 37x12.5/17 on my 06 all stock. Trim a little plastic and some control arm rubbing but nothing major. Was worth it. Fully flexed no problem
